Dolmades
Dolmades are vine-leaf rolls filled with seasoned rice, herbs, and sometimes vegetables. This classic Greek dish is notable for its historical roots dating back centuries through Byzantine and Ottoman culinary traditions. Sarma
Sarma is a classic Balkan rice dish featuring fermented cabbage leaves tightly wrapped with seasoned rice and a savory filling of ground meat—typically beef or lamb. This dish reflects centuries of culinary tradition in the region, rooted in Ottoman influences.
